2012 has been a great year for Akshara Foundation. There has been a lot of excitement around our programmes, community events, volunteering events and many other such activities.

One such event was moving into a new, spacious office. Though our current office is very close to the older one, it is more spacious. We occupy the ground and the first floors while our friends at Pratham Books sit in the second floor. 


To make our work environment more appealing and encouraging, we decided to add a splash of color and give a make-over to the office. The once empty walls and pillar are now filled with colorful, attractive paintings. The idea was conceived by Megha Vishwanath of the KLP team and all of us at Akshara joined in to create this transformation. Here’s what Megha has to say:
A little splash of color welcoming you into your work day can never hurt, can it?! And on the contrary it’s that pleasant distraction for those who like to stare at something during those moments of deep or vacant thought. Having moved to our new office in early August, we decided it is no more staring at the white ceiling but staring at this vibrant pillar here in Akshara’s office.

The pillar was perfect for the build up of a horizon – all the way from green grass to blue skies. But the fact that one can go round a pillar lent to our imagination an interesting challenge. What goes round and round? Our very colorful answer turned out to be – “The carousel”! It’s one of those fun experiences – you put a coin in it, it takes you up and down, round and round and makes you feel all happy at the end of it. And what joy it brings to children! There were other elements a kite and a festoon that brought to the pillar the sense of a merry fair – an escapade and a moment of being a child again!
 

Under the staircase, in keeping with the theme, we had the larger than life expressions of some of the elements represented on the pillar as well – a dandelion (inspired by the KLP logo), clouds and the sun, a butterfly and colorful kites! 

While they fast disappear in the rest of this city, we decided to paint ourselves a line of trees – in different sizes and shapes all the way leading upto the pillar. Half a dozen little ones from a nearby Anganwadi graciously left us thumb-prints for the fall colors of the foliage. And that’s what will make these trees special for us! Note there’s an owl along the way – one of our colleagues insisted on having one – to negate the myth and superstition around this beautiful creature – and in the true spirit of co-existing with nature as splendid as it is!
 

A true collaborative effort, it had so many of our colleagues standing funnily sometimes, squatting, kneeling and in other unusual yogic stances to bring ourselves some happy times and reminder of who the benefactors of all our work are really!
